Watch the winning round as Gregory Wathelet triumphed in the first leg of the 2017 Rolex Grand Slam of Showjumping in Aachen.
The Belgian and his horse Coree jumped to victory in Aachen to claim the first leg in the year of the Rolex Grand Slam of Show Jumping, the first major win of his career.
"I did warn you what a good rider he is," showjumping expert James Fisher told Sky Sports. "He's magical on his turns and angled them to perfection.
"He didn't easily win it but showed the class of rider he is. He's a showjumper's showjumper and a very popular winner.
"You never know with Aachen. It's one of the toughest places to jump, it's technical, big and full of drama and theatre. It certainly didn't disappoint. It was a great jump off and a fantastic performance from all of them. Top jumping."
